panthan
Panth (also panthan, meaning "path" in Sanskrit) is the term used for several religious traditions in India. A panth is founded by a guru or an acharya, and is often led by scholars or senior practitioners of the tradition. Some of the major panths in India are:

Panthan
Panthan is the term used for several religious traditions in India. A panth is founded by a guru or an acharya, and is often led by scholars or senior practitioners of the tradition. Some of the major panthas in India are: ⁕Khalsa Panth ⁕Nanak Panth ⁕Sahaja Panth ⁕Kabir Panth ⁕Dadu Panth ⁕Tera Panth ⁕Satnami Panth ⁕Nath Panth ⁕Varkari Panth ⁕Sat Panth ⁕Rasul Panth ⁕Pagal Panth
